Drugs Mafia: History sheeter among 2 injured in scuffle at Kings Hotel; associates flee

STATE TIMES NEWS

JAMMU: Two persons allegedly involved in drugs peddling were seriously injured in a violent scuffle under mysterious circumstances at Kings Hotel on Railway Road in the Trikuta Nagar area late last night.
The victims have been identified as Umar (26), son of Abrar and Kapil Sharma-both residents of Chowadi. According to police sources, the incident took place in room number 203, which was booked by one Ashutosh, son of Vijay Kumar, resident of Nanak Nagar, already booked in number of cases.
Police said Umar and Kapil had gone to meet Ashutosh at the hotel. During the meeting, an altercation broke out, and Ashutosh, allegedly with the help of an associate, attacked both Kapil and Umar with a sharp-edged weapons, leaving them grievously injured. The motive behind the assault remains unclear.
Both Umar and Kapil were immediately rushed to Government Medical College (GMC) Hospital Jammu, where they are said to be in critical condition. Today evening, Umar was shifted to DMC Ludhiana for specialised treatment.
Following the incident, Ashutosh and his associate fled the scene and are currently absconding. A case has been registered, and a manhunt has been launched to trace the absconders.
Preliminary investigations have revealed that both Ashutosh and Kapil Sharma have a history of criminal involvement and are reportedly associated with drug trafficking activities. Notably, Kapil Sharma had previously operated a drug de-addiction centre in Samba, which, as per police records, was allegedly being used as a front for illegal drug peddling. The centre was reportedly situated on state land and it was also demolished.
Police are also investigating the possibility of a drug-related dispute being the trigger for the assault. Senior officers have assured that a thorough probe is underway and strict action will be taken against all involved.
Police is investigating that why a local youth had booked a hotel room in Jammu City and how the hotel management allowed a local to book a room for meeting friends.
Sources said, these youth many times used to book a room here in this hotel. Police is working on various theories to bust the drugs mafia.
